ENGLISH ROOT WORD: limit "boundary", "frontier" from Latin limes, limitare

Go Korean Version

 

【limit】 is word-forming element usually meaning "boundary, frontier"
from Latin "limes, limitare"

eliminate ★★[3703] verb from eliminate 〈 limit
【DEFINITION】 To eliminate something, especially something you do not want or need, means to remove it completely.
【Declension/Conjugation】 eliminated eliminated eliminating eliminates
【SYNONYM】 knock out, get rid of
【ROOTs】 e(ex); out, out of, forth limin(limit); boundary, frontier ate; verb suffix
【Etymology】 《Latin ex limineoff the threshold
【First Known Meaning】 thrust out of doors, expel
【DERIVATIVEs】 eliminability, eliminable, eliminant, elimination, eliminative, eliminator, eliminatory, eliminate

limit ★★★★[1314] noun from limit
【DEFINITION】 ① a point beyond which it is not possible to go
② a point beyond which someone is not allowed to go
③ an amount or number that is the highest or lowest allowed
【SYNONYM】 restriction, restraint
【ROOTs】 limit; boundary, frontier
【Etymology】 《Latin limitareto bound, limit, fix
【First Known Meaning】 boundary, frontier
【DERIVATIVEs】 limit, limitable, limitableness, limitary, limitation, limitative, limitless, limitlessly, limitlessness



limitation ★★★[2948] noun from limit
【DEFINITION】 The limitation of something is the act or process of controlling or reducing it.
【pl.】 limitations
【SYNONYM】 restriction, restraint, curb
【ROOTs】 limit; boundary, frontier ation(ion); noun suffix
【Etymology】 《Latin limitareto bound, limit, fix
【DERIVATIVEs】 limit, limitable, limitableness, limitary, limitation, limitative, limitless, limitlessly, limitlessness

limited ★★★★[1733] adjective from limit
【DEFINITION】 not high or great in number, amount, etc.
【COMPOSITION】 limit + ed
【ROOTs】 limit; boundary, frontier ed; adjective suffix
【Etymology】 《Latin limitareto bound, limit, fix
【DERIVATIVEs】 limitedly, limitedness, limited
